A delicate, slanted cursive with long, looping strokes and a light, hairline presence. Letterforms are built from smooth, continuous curves with tapered terminals and occasional entry/exit swashes, especially in capitals. Uppercase characters are tall and expressive with generous ascenders and open bowls, while lowercase forms stay compact with small counters and a restrained x-height, creating a high vertical rhythm. Spacing and widths vary naturally, reinforcing a handwritten cadence while maintaining consistent stroke behavior across the set.
This style works best for short-form, decorative text such as invitations, event stationery, signatures, headings, and brand marks that want a handwritten, upscale feel. It can also suit pull quotes or captions when set at larger sizes where the hairline strokes and loops remain clear.
The font reads as graceful and intimate, with a classic handwritten charm. Its thin lines and flowing loops give it a refined, romantic tone suited to understated elegance rather than loud display.
The design appears intended to emulate fine pen handwriting with a focus on elegance and fluid motion. Emphasis is placed on expressive capitals and a light, airy texture that communicates sophistication and personal warmth.
Capitals carry much of the personality through extended lead-in strokes and rounded flourish, while numerals keep the same light, cursive logic with simple, readable shapes. The overall texture is quiet and open on the page, with plenty of white space between strokes and counters.
